Using an expired disposable camera may result in poor image quality, color distortion, or no photos developing at all. The expired film may also cause the camera to malfunction, leading to a waste of time and money.

How long does film last in a disposable camera before it expires?

The film in a disposable camera typically lasts for about two years before it expires.


Is expired film still process able?

Yes, Expired film is still processable. I just took pictures with an expired 35mm disposable camera that expired in 2002... and the pictures came out! The colors were not as vibrant as they would have been with new film, but not so bad for 7 year old film. If I wasn't comparing the pictures with a new roll of film, you wouldn't notice the difference.
